Energy saving and compliance: comfort where needed, energy where it counts
The use of thermostatic devices for radiators is required by Italian regulations (often referred to as Law 10/91) and arises from the need to reduce waste. The Watts 148A, coupled with a thermostatic valve, adapts the power emitted by the radiator to the desired temperature and utilizes the free contributions present in the room: sun, appliances, presence of people. In practice, when the environment naturally heats up, the valve reduces the flow of hot water, avoiding unnecessary consumption. The energy efficiency class I further enhances the installation from an efficiency perspective.
How it works: liquid element and automatic regulation
Inside the knob is a liquid-sensitive element that reacts to changes in ambient temperature: expanding or contracting, it acts on the valve shutter stem. If the temperature exceeds the set value (set point), the actuator commands the progressive closure of the shutter, reducing the flow of hot water to the radiator; if the temperature drops, it initiates the opening and increases circulation. The Watts thermostatic valve is designed with low thermal inertia, with a response time of less than 30 minutes, so the system reacts quickly and more easily maintains the desired temperature.
Simple adjustment and antifreeze protection
The adjustment is intuitive thanks to the graduated scale from 0 to 5, with an adjustment range of 8°C 28°C. There is also an antifreeze position at 8°C, useful for rarely inhabited houses, second homes, and technical rooms: it prevents the temperature from dropping too low, protecting the system and reducing risks associated with cold. The possibility of temperature limitation and blocking is a plus in shared environments (offices, hospitality structures, condominiums), where controlled set-points are desired.
